2.10 Do not retail store any passwords or secrets during the application binary. Usually do not utilize a generic shared top secret for integration Along with the backend (like password embedded in code). Mobile application binaries can be easily downloaded and reverse engineered.
A coordinated publish follows the exact same pattern, although the locking happens differently. You will discover other useful techniques on NSFileCoordinator for conditions like looking at a file, building a alter, then creating the new edition.
One more destructive application although reading the telephone memory contents, stumbles on this knowledge since the unit is Jailbroken
Tuts+ is a wonderful spot for beginners, not only as a result of very easy to go through tutorials, and also thanks to picked subject areas. They protect authentic Basic principles of iOS development — building initially application, very first methods into Foundation and UIKit, how table watch works and a lot of, a lot of far more.
That could cause a connect with to application:handleWatchKitExtensionRequest:reply: within the containing app's application delegate. This method serves like a live notification but could also carry arbitrary information.
The components, settings and metadata of an Android application are explained in the AndroidManifest.xml
GREAT web site for Discovering iOS development, Particularly Swift — you're going to be Finding out along with the creator, as he’s now Discovering much too. Web site is new and up to date frequently, unquestionably insert it on your RSS reader. A lot of attention-grabbing matters about Swift.
Generate degree of assurance framework based upon controls executed. This is able to be subjective to a specific level, but It will be helpful in guiding businesses who would like to accomplish a particular level of possibility administration determined by the threats and vulnerabilities
Make use of rate restricting and throttling on a for every-consumer/IP basis (if user identification is obtainable) to reduce the possibility from DoS sort of attacks. Execute a particular Test of your respective code for virtually any sensitive details unintentionally transferred concerning the mobile application and also the again-close servers, as well as other exterior interfaces (e.g. is locale or other information bundled transmissions?). Make sure the server rejects all unencrypted requests discover here which it is aware of ought to normally arrive encrypted. Session Management
This course is targeted at Absolutely everyone keen on producing indigenous mobile iOS applications working with this new SDK. Be sure to Be aware: To fully gain from this course and also the palms-on physical exercise you should concentrate to the detailed course conditions and the segment about development programs. Here is what some individuals are stating about the training course: “
This is actually the very first launch (February 2013) on the Mobile Application Threat Design formulated by the Original job group (stated at the end of this release). Development began mid-2011 and it is being introduced in beta type for general public comment and input.
In this particular part, We are going to notice unique procedures an attacker can use to get to the info. This data could be sensitive facts on the product or something sensitive for the app itself.
In case you have an interest in Mastering more about the SAP and Apple partnership, remember to enroll during the openSAP course
Alternatively you may find the File ▸ New Task… entry in the menu, should you previously made a task before.